Description | Lump of Melted Glass and Roof Tiles Donated by Takao Kobayashi 1,050 m from the hypocenter; Kita-eno-machi (now, Nishi-tokaichi-machi) Kensaku Matsushima (53) and his wife Koyoshi Kobayashi (47) were exposed and burned at home, but managed to get their burnt and tattered bodies to a relative’s home. Kensaku died on the 21st and Koyoshi on the 23rd. Their daughter Sadako (13) was exposed while helping with building demolition. Her remains were never found. When their oldest son, Takao (then, 27), was demobilized and returned home in 1946, he was astounded to find a burnt plain as far as he could see. He searched for his family until a relative told him they had all died. |
